The original plan for DREDGE’s paid DLC, entitled The Iron Rig, was to have it release sometime in Q4 2023. Unfortunately, those who’ve been holding out for the DLC will now need to muster up a bit more patience.

Black Salt Games has announced that they’re pushing The Iron Rig DLC into 2024. No specific date has been given, but the dev team did share a lengthy message explaining the delay. You can read that message in full below.

We have an announcement to make, and yes, it’s about a delay – but please hear us out.

A few months ago, we were thrilled to share with you our release plans for the first DLC for DREDGE, ‘The Iron Rig.’ Originally, we planned to spend a few months crafting this exciting addition and release it in Q4 this year. However, as we progressed, we were faced with the reality that, given the time of the year, we’d need more lead time to coordinate our marketing and make the launch as exciting as it could be.

We were genuinely disheartened because we knew had made a commitment to all our dedicated players, but we firmly believed there was only one path forward and that was to delay ‘The Iron Rig’ until next year while still delivering an exciting DLC to our players in 2023.

So, we’ve been hard at work crafting some additional content and we can’t wait to share more details with you soon, including when it will be available and how much it will cost. We understand that this isn’t what we had originally promised but we hope you understand. Your support means the world to us.

Thank you for being an essential part of the DREDGE community and please stay tuned for more info soon!

All the best from the team at Black Salt Games.
